>Where do I setup the options for the bttv module? |
4 |
> |
5 |
>I need to set the card=40 and tuner =6, no matter what I try I still get: |
6 |
> |
7 |
> |
8 |
> |
9 |
>>From the above, you can see that bttv is loaded with "card=0 and tuner=-1" |
10 |
>I've tried setting in /etc/modules.d/aliases as |
11 |
> |
12 |
>alias char-major-81 bttv |
13 |
>options bttv card=40 tuner=6 |
14 |
>options tuner type=6 |
15 |
> |
16 |
>This does not seem to have an affect. Is there some docs that show the |
17 |
>proper way of doing this in Gentoo? |
18 |
> |
19 |
> |
20 |
> |
21 |
I created a file "bttv" in /etc/modules.d/ and placed the following |
22 |
within it: |
23 |
|
24 |
alias char-major-81 bttv |
25 |
options bttv card=40 tuner=6 |
26 |
|
27 |
This did the trick : ) |
